Unveiling the Power of Financial Modeling: A Comprehensive Guide

Financial Modeling

Financial modeling is a powerful tool used by businesses, analysts, and investors to make informed decisions, analyze financial performance, and forecast future outcomes. By creating mathematical representations of financial data and relationships, financial models help stakeholders understand the implications of different scenarios, assess risk, and evaluate the financial viability of projects and investments. In this detailed exploration, we’ll uncover the principles of financial modeling, its applications, best practices, and how it can drive smarter decision-making in various domains.

Understanding Financial Modeling

Financial modeling involves the creation of mathematical models that simulate the financial performance of a business, project, or investment based on historical data, assumptions, and forecasts. These models typically include income statements, balance sheets, cash flow statements, and other financial metrics to analyze profitability, cash flow, and valuation.

Applications of Financial Modeling

1. Valuation

Financial modeling is commonly used for valuing companies, assets, and investments. By projecting future cash flows, discounting them back to present value using an appropriate discount rate, and comparing the results to market prices or comparable transactions, analysts can determine the intrinsic value of an asset or investment opportunity.

2. Budgeting and Planning

Financial models are essential for budgeting and planning purposes, allowing businesses to forecast revenues, expenses, and cash flows, set targets and benchmarks, and allocate resources effectively. By creating detailed budget models, organizations can track performance against projections, identify variances, and make adjustments to achieve financial goals.

3. Capital Budgeting

Financial modeling plays a crucial role in capital budgeting decisions, helping businesses evaluate potential investment projects and assess their financial feasibility and return on investment. By estimating project costs, revenues, and cash flows over the project’s lifecycle, businesses can determine whether to proceed with the investment or allocate resources elsewhere.

4. Risk Analysis

Financial models enable stakeholders to conduct risk analysis and scenario planning to assess the impact of different factors and events on financial performance. By running sensitivity analysis, Monte Carlo simulations, or stress testing, analysts can quantify the potential risks and uncertainties associated with a project or investment and develop strategies to mitigate them.

Best Practices in Financial Modeling

1. Start with a Clear Objective

Define the purpose and scope of the financial model and establish clear objectives and assumptions before starting the modeling process. Clearly define inputs, outputs, and key performance indicators (KPIs) to ensure the model aligns with the intended use case.

2. Use Consistent and Accurate Data

Ensure that the financial model uses accurate and up-to-date data from reliable sources. Use consistent methodologies and assumptions throughout the model to maintain accuracy and reliability.

3. Keep it Simple and Transparent

Avoid unnecessary complexity and keep the financial model transparent and easy to understand. Use clear labeling, logical organization, and concise formulas to facilitate usability and interpretation by stakeholders.

4. Test and Validate the Model

Thoroughly test the financial model to ensure accuracy, robustness, and reliability. Validate the model’s outputs against historical data, benchmarks, or alternative methodologies to verify its predictive power and effectiveness.

Tools for Financial Modeling

Several software tools are available to facilitate financial modeling, including Microsoft Excel, Google Sheets, and specialized financial modeling software such as Tableau, MATLAB, or Python libraries like Pandas and NumPy. These tools offer features for data analysis, visualization, scenario analysis, and automation, making it easier to build, analyze, and communicate complex financial models.


In conclusion, financial modeling is a versatile and indispensable tool for analyzing financial data, making informed decisions, and driving business success. Whether used for valuation, budgeting, capital budgeting, or risk analysis, financial models provide valuable insights into the financial performance and prospects of businesses, projects, and investments. By following best practices, using reliable data, and leveraging appropriate tools, stakeholders can harness the power of financial modeling to optimize decision-making and achieve their financial objectives.